Understanding the Core Mechanics and Risk Assessment

At the heart of this type of game lies a random number generator (RNG) that determines the point at which the airplane will ‘crash.’ This crash point is entirely unpredictable, making each round independent of the previous ones. It’s crucial to remember this independence; past results offer no insight into future outcomes. Effective gameplay isn't about predicting the crash point, but rather about managing your risk tolerance and knowing when to withdraw your stake. Many players employ various strategies, ranging from conservative approaches, where they aim for small, consistent profits, to more aggressive tactics, hoping for a significant multiplier. The choice of strategy often comes down to individual comfort levels and financial goals. Understanding the volatility is a key element of successful play.

One common strategy involves setting a target multiplier. For example, a player might decide they're happy with a 2x return and will cash out as soon as the multiplier reaches that point. This approach minimizes risk, but also limits potential profits. Conversely, a player seeking a larger payout might wait for a multiplier of 10x or higher, accepting the higher risk of the plane crashing before they can cash out. The inherent tension between risk and reward is what makes this game so compelling. It's a delicate balancing act, and there's no one-size-fits-all solution.

The Importance of Bankroll Management

Regardless of the chosen strategy, sound bankroll management is paramount. It’s essential to determine a budget you’re comfortable losing and never exceed it. Dividing your bankroll into smaller units and betting only a small percentage of it on each round is a prudent approach. This helps to mitigate the impact of losing streaks and extends your playtime. Resisting the urge to chase losses is also vital. Attempting to recover lost funds by increasing your bet size often leads to even greater losses. Discipline and a rational mindset are essential attributes for any player hoping to succeed in this environment. Treating it as entertainment, rather than a guaranteed income source, is a healthy perspective.

Analyzing your betting history can also be helpful. Tracking your wins and losses can reveal patterns in your behavior and identify areas where you might be making mistakes. Are you consistently cashing out too early, leaving potential profits on the table? Or are you holding on for too long, resulting in frequent crashes? Self-awareness is crucial for continuous improvement.

Advanced Techniques and Automated Strategies

For those looking to take their gameplay to the next level, more advanced techniques exist. These often involve analyzing historical data, although, as mentioned previously, this data has limited predictive value due to the inherent randomness of the game. Some players experiment with Martingale systems, where they double their bet after each loss, hoping to recover their losses with a single win. However, this strategy is extremely risky and requires a substantial bankroll to withstand prolonged losing streaks. It’s crucial to understand the potential drawbacks of any advanced technique before implementing it.

Another approach involves using automated betting bots. These bots can be programmed to automatically cash out at a specific multiplier or to follow a pre-defined betting pattern. While bots can eliminate emotional decision-making, they don't guarantee profits and can still be vulnerable to losing streaks. Carefully researching and understanding the risks associated with automated betting is essential before using these tools.
